Emmy Russell faced enormous pressure to carve out her own career in the music industry after being born in the huge shadow of her renowned grandmother, “Loretta Lynn.” Her breakthrough came on American Idol!

Loretta Lynn’s granddaughter, Emmy Russell, wowed everyone on American Idol with her strong original song ‘Skinny’ during her audition.

Emmy had high expectations growing up with a renowned person like her grandmother, Loretta Lynn. This frequently leads to self-doubt and continual evaluation of one’s talents.

Patsy, Emmy’s mother, expressed her daughter’s nervousness ahead of her audition. She discussed the difficulty of breaking from the shadow of a musical family. Patsy said, “How can I fill their shoes? Well, you don’t.” You create your own shadow.”

Emmy played ‘Skinny’ on the piano. This song is about her struggles with an eating condition. Her performance moved the judges. Katy Perry said to Emmy, “I don’t think you should compare yourself to what Grandma was. You’re completely different.” You should not put so much pressure on yourself.” Following that, the judges unanimously voted yes. This brought Emmy to tears.

Katy Perry complimented Emmy’s songwriting abilities. She stated, “Emmy, you’re an A+ songwriter.” Perry was in her final season on American Idol. She comforted Emmy about her special skill. She pleaded with Emmy not to compare herself to her grandmother.
